An Estimated 10 million Americans have what's called a TMJ disease. TMJ disease is really a term used to describe a set of conditions based on issues with the jawbone joint or TMJ (temporomandibular joint). Occasionally it's a debilitating condition which range from minor discomfort to severe pain and there are lots of different body components that may potentially be impacted.

Additionally, there Are several other conditions Used for this particular condition. There's TMD (temporomandibular joint disease ), TMJ syndrome, only TMJ, along with other names too.

The Groups of individuals most vulnerable to getting the TMJ disease are girls between the ages of 30 and 50 who clench their jaw or grind their teeth in their sleep, have a metabolic or nourishment disorder, have a higher stress level and also have malocclusion (poor bite). Researchers are doing research to discover whether there's a connection between female hormones and TMJ disorder because this ailment afflicts twice as many women as men.

The TMJ (jawbone joint) is Composed of many different Components including muscles, bones, tendons, nerves, nerves, and a disk between the bones substantially enjoy the disks in your spine, and other connective tissues. Your TMJ can also be among the most utilized joints in the human body as it is used to eat and speak.

Besides headaches and also a Sore jaw yet another symptom of this TMJ disease is if your jaw makes a snapping or popping sound as it opens or closes. A lot of individuals really have this symptom however when there is not any pain associated with this there is no reason for therapy. Even if there's a tiny pain associated with this symptom it'll simply be temporary or occur in cycles.

Some physicians believe the major cause of the disorder is stress. They believe that anxiety causes patients to grind their teeth in their sleep. Afterward, by grinding their teeth, they hurt the TMJ and trigger the disease. Other doctors believe patients can develop the disease as well as also the pain and distress will get the individual to create high pressure levels.

The only thing for certain right now isthere is No established evaluation for analysis, there are no established therapies which have been demonstrated, and there aren't any specialized training classes so there aren't any actual TMJ specialists.
